In General Motors (GM) vehicle diagnostics and module programming, technicians frequently hit a wall when relying solely on standard dealership tools. Standard platforms like the Service Programming System (SPS) are highly restrictive, built primarily to flash stock calibrations onto unmodified vehicles. For advanced automotive locksmiths, tuners, and electrical technicians, the serves as a vital bridge. It allows users to manipulate calibration data and program Electronic Control Units (ECUs) without the rigid parameters imposed by factory servers. Understanding the Core Architecture: What is GM DPS?
